Joshua Klingenstein has extensive experience in capital planning and transportation program management, currently serving as the Director of Capital Program Planning at MBTA since October 2019, after progressing through various roles including Manager, Senior Analyst, and Analyst in the same department. Prior to MBTA, Joshua worked as a Program Associate for Transportation at the Northwest Municipal Conference and as a NUPIP Research and Analysis Fellow at the Chicago Metropolitan Agency for Planning (CMAP). Earlier career roles include a Data Coder at KMR Group, Inc., a Policy Intern at the Chicago Coalition for the Homeless, and a Research Assistant at Northwestern University. Joshua earned a Bachelor’s Degree in Economics and International Studies from Northwestern University, where studies were completed from 2013 to 2017.
